What is a table top belt sander used for?

A benchtop belt sander is a stationary tool that sands wood or metal using a long, rectangular belt that runs over two pulleys. It’s often used to smooth out rough surfaces and remove mill marks and true miters.

When should I use a belt sander?

What are Belt Sanders? Belt sanders are multiuse tools. They are commonly used for trimming to a scribed line (photo), sanding very rough surfaces, leveling surfaces (like a replacement board in a hardwood floor) and freehand rounding and shaping.

Can I sand my table top?

Begin sanding the entire wood surface with coarse-grit sandpaper (80 grit), then progress to medium-grit sandpaper (150 grit), and then to a fine-grit sandpaper (220 grit) before you stain. When sanding, sand the entire table with each grit before moving on to the next grit.

What is better belt sander or orbital sander?

A belt sander is more effective for large materials, while the orbital sander is ideal for small spaces and pieces of furniture. A belt sander works effectively on flat surfaces, while an orbital sander can work with various angles.

How do you sand a table top smooth?

Do most of the initial sanding with 100-grit sandpaper, then step up to 150-grit and do a final pass with 220-grit to smooth out the grain. Finish to a smoothness that makes you happy. Carefully remove all sanding dust with a tack cloth.

How do you sand a wooden table top?

Sand the table, beginning with the coarsest-grit sandpaper (100 grit) and sanding in the direction of the wood grain. Next, sand the table with the 150-grit paper, and finish by sanding with the 220-grit paper. Wipe the surface of the entire table using the tack cloth.

Why does my belt sander keeps breaking belts?

Heat, humidity, and age can contribute to belt seam failures, but they’re not the only causes. Check that your belts are turning in the direction indicated on the inside face. When not using your sander, release the tension on the belt.
